WebDec 12, 2024 · What is Python Timeit? Python Timeit is a method in the Python library to measure the execution time taken by the given code fragment. The Python library runs the code several times(1 million times) and provides the minimum time taken from the given piece of code. It is a useful method that helps us in checking the code performance. Webnamespace). To measure the execution time of the first statement, use the. timeit () method. The repeat () method is a convenience to call. timeit () multiple times and return a list of results. The statements may contain newlines, as …
Python Timer Functions: Three Ways to Monitor Your Code
WebDivision (3) of overall duration t2 by interval unit t3. Returns a float object. t1 = t2 / f or t1 = t2 / i. Delta divided by a float or an int. The result is rounded to the nearest multiple of timedelta.resolution using round-half-to-even. t1 = t2 // i or t1 = t2 // t3. The floor is computed and the remainder (if any) is thrown away. WebJul 4, 2024 · Comparison with Python's timeit module. Python's timeit module not only has the timeit() function, but also a repeat() function and a Timer class. While not all the functionality in the timeit module is useful for C++, if you want to provide something that is familiar to a Python user, then it might be nice to implement Timer and repeat() at least. panavia cement composition
Python timeit - Letstacle
Web本文讲解"怎么用装饰器扩展Python计时器",希望能够解决相关问题。. 1. 每次调用函数时使用 Timer:. 当我们在一个py文件里多次调用函数 do_something (),那么这将会变得非常繁琐并且难以维护。. 2. 将代码包装在上下文管理器中的函数中:. def do_something … Webtime.asctime([t]) ¶. Convert a tuple or struct_time representing a time as returned by gmtime () or localtime () to a string of the following form: 'Sun Jun 20 23:21:05 1993'. The day … pana vanilla icecream